Works fine
This is a simple fiber cleaver which produces good cuts in my testing. It is very small and comes with a fabric covered hard zippered enclosure for protection. There are very few adjustments - blade height, turn the blade, and adjusted the stop block. It does the job. The blade carriage locks in the back once the cleave is complete, probably to avoid striking the fiber twice, so it needs to be reset when you open the top. Higher end cleavers use a more automatic return so it’s like a push button, and they do something to avoid hitting the fiber again after a cleave. If you do a lot of fiber this extra step will be annoying. Also the fiber holder is fixed in the cleaver, so you have to line the fiber up with the cleaver open, then remove the fiber and put it into whatever fixture your splicer has. Again, additional steps, and getting the fiber into place will take a little more time.Great for beginners and those who rarely need this type of tool.The strippers are normal and work as expected. They don’t come with a bag or fit into the cleaver bag. Nice extra, you can never have too many of these so you can always throw one away if it starts messing up your fiber.
